Output 66fea75f81fb6122e88173488f84c343ca176fa1767e4f238f700679887c1dad:0

value
1332817401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ff1f92fa41f6ddb6fe8f1c584c201e0dc1f0b10 OP_EQUALVERIFY OP_CHECKSIG
address
DJGD3J6eWSQM5nxwQt2wnLRxDjFTph4wh4
transaction
66fea75f81fb6122e88173488f84c343ca176fa1767e4f238f700679887c1dad